服務器監控方案CactiEZ V10.1


   

CactiEZ中文版是最簡單有效的Cacti中文解決方案,整合Spine,RRDTool和美化字體。集成Thold,Monitor,Syslog,Weathermap,Realtime,Errorimage,Mobile,Aggregate以及Apache,Squid,F5,Nginx,MySQL等模板。支持多種硬盤控制器和陣列卡,基於CentOS6,啟動速度更快,支持EXT4文件系統,原生rsyslog更穩定。全中文頁面,中文圖形,支持郵件報警,支持聲音報警,安裝方便使用簡單。

================================================================================================ 
說明:CactiEZ中文版V10.1是基於CentOS 6.0系統,整合Cacti等相關軟件,重新編譯而成的一個操作系統!

優點:省去了復雜煩瑣的Cacti配置過程,安裝之后即可使用,全部中文化,界面更友好

缺點:CactiEZ是一個完整的操作系統,需要專門一台電腦才能安裝使用

系統運維 溫馨提醒:qihang01原創內容版權所有,轉載請注明出處及原文鏈接

具體案例:

1、CactiEZ監控主機

IP:192.168.21.175

子網掩碼:255.255.255.0

網關:192.168.21.2

DNS:8.8.8.8

8.8.4.4

2、Windows客戶機

系統:Windows Server 2003

IP:192.168.21.130,與CactiEZ監控主機在同一個局域網內

3、Linux客戶機

系統:CentOS 6.2

IP:192.168.21.169,與CactiEZ監控主機在同一個局域網內

目的:使用CactiEZ監控主機對Windows客戶機和Linux客戶機進行監控

一、安裝CactiEZ監控主機

CactiEZ下載地址(下載方法:復制下載地址到迅雷等下載工具里面進行下載):

32位下載: 迅雷下載(將下面地址復制到迅雷中)

http://dl1.c6.sendfile.vip.xunlei.com:8000/CactiEZ%2D10%2E1%2Di386%2Eiso?key=dd5b704f43cf70024bdf787a63dc04d9&file_url=%2Fgdrive%2Fresource%2FFC%2FB7%2FFC7E27B0B23A01A48F274110DCC4140F3F7320B7&file_type=0&authkey=544A3F701F8895CC3635134BF55EB773D66C4955D756CE30E998FCC4C7127B7C&exp_time=1367960567&from_uid=280987&task_id=5835371868065652226&get_uid=1007077871&f=lixian.vip.xunlei.com&reduce_cdn=1&fid=qiNQY1Vfn/cqwouUauYF/CFZC7EAoI0VAAAAAPx+J7CyOgGkjydBENzEFA8/cyC3&mid=666&threshold=150&tid=48973CB84832FCD2313FC5A7B80C1F70&srcid=7&verno=1" file_size="361603072" cid="AA235063555F9FF72AC28B946AE605FC21590BB1" gcid="FC7E27B0B23A01A48F274110DCC4140F3F7320B7" gcid_resid="tSH9tFE9k7RLH7QRHGwRQGlZH7z4HFOPtOQGQGO4HOb3t7z3H7RLQxiTQFO0gFfTQ7O0HGk0gFH.

64位下載:迅雷下載 (將下面地址復制到迅雷中)

http://dl1.c10.sendfile.vip.xunlei.com:8000/CactiEZ%2D10%2E1%2Dx86%5F64%2Eiso?key=53fa47f5091b0e3d99c1aaded218600f&file_url=%2Fgdrive%2Fresource%2F6F%2FCA%2F6F103ECECBDC4F31596DE91AF2BEAF33EF6D83CA&file_type=0&authkey=9A3A0641445805A4257F3263BEC82F4B37B97F9DC1C52CD39132C406336E9D33&exp_time=1367960567&from_uid=280987&task_id=5835371868065652226&get_uid=1007077871&f=lixian.vip.xunlei.com&reduce_cdn=1&fid=icHGUsUtxEGBTcLjslYwvOaTghMAKFcYAAAAAG8QPs7L3E8xWW3pGvK+rzPvbYPK&mid=666&threshold=150&tid=E1CE3A8A5AA1C5D11EE52F960233F29A&srcid=7&verno=1" file_size="408365056" cid="89C1C652C52DC441814DC2E3B25630BCE6938213" gcid="6F103ECECBDC4F31596DE91AF2BEAF33EF6D83CA" gcid_resid="QSb_HGQwk4AGkStGQOb3HF-0QStwgFwRt72Lt-wZH3Qwt7oOgGQGkAiTQFO0gFfTQ7O0HGk0gFO.

下面以安裝32為CactiEZ系統為例,64位系統安裝方法相同

系統運維 溫馨提醒:qihang01原創內容版權所有,轉載請注明出處及原文鏈接

特別說明:安裝CactiEZ的主機磁盤空間必須要在10G以上,否則不能安裝

如果是虛擬機安裝,請設置磁盤空間大於10G

把下載好的CactiEZ系統鏡像刻錄為光盤,使用光盤成功引導系統之后,會出現下面的界面

選擇第一項,安裝CactiEZ,回車,出現如下界面

檢查安裝介質,這里選擇Skip直接跳過,回車,系統會自動安裝

系統運維 溫馨提醒:qihang01原創內容版權所有,轉載請注明出處及原文鏈接

系統已經安裝完成,點擊Reboot重啟系統!

二、設置CactiEZ監控主機

默認安裝好之后,系統登錄用戶root,密碼CactiEZ

以下操作在登錄系統之后進行

1、修改root登錄密碼

passwd root #回車之后,提示輸入2次新密碼

出現:passwd:all authentication tokens updated successfully.說明密碼修改成功

2、修改IP地址、子網掩碼、網關、DNS等信息

vi /etc/sysconfig/network-scripts/ifcfg-eth0

DEVICE="eth0"

BOOTPROTO="static"

DNS1="8.8.8.8"

DNS2="8.8.4.4"

GATEWAY="192.168.21.2"

HOSTNAME="CactiEZ.local"

HWADDR="00:0C:29:AF:98:C1"

IPADDR="192.168.21.175"

MTU="1500"

NETMASK="255.255.255.0"

NM_CONTROLLED="yes"

ONBOOT="yes"

:wq! #保存

service network restart #重啟網絡

3、登錄CactiEZ監控平台

瀏覽器里面輸入

用戶名:admin,默認密碼:admin

為了安全考慮,第一次登錄之后必須修改默認密碼,修改好之后點保存,登錄到CactiEZ Web監控平台

現在CactiEZ監控主機安裝完成。

二、配置被監控的Windows客戶機

說明:要使用CactiEZ監控一台Windows主機,需要在被監控的主機上面安裝snmp(簡單網絡管理協議)

1、下面開始安裝配置snmp

開始-設置-控制面板-添加或刪除程序-添加刪除Windows組件

找到管理和監視工具,前面打勾,在點詳細信息:簡單網絡管理協議(SNMP)前面打勾,然后卻確定,下一步

系統運維 溫馨提醒:qihang01原創內容版權所有,轉載請注明出處及原文鏈接

開始安裝,直到安裝完成(注意:安裝過程中會提示插入Windows系統光盤,這個需要提前准備好。)

2、配置SNMP服務

開始-運行,輸入services.msc 確定,打開服務管理

找到SNMP Service選項,雙擊打開,切換到安全選項,在接受團體名稱下面點擊添加,出現SNMP服務配置

團體權限:只讀

團體名稱:public

最后確定

選中:接受來自這些主機的SNMP數據包,點下面的添加,在主機名,IP或IPX地址中輸入CactiEZ監控主機的IP地

這里輸入:192.168.21.175,最后,應用,確定。

最后重啟Windows系統

三、配置被監控的Linux客戶機

說明:要使用CactiEZ監控一台Linux主機,需要在被監控的主機上安裝net-snmp等相關的軟件包;

同時需要開啟防火牆UDP161端口

1、開啟防火牆UDP161端口

vi /etc/sysconfig/iptables #編輯防火牆配置

-A INPUT -m state --state NEW -m udp -p udp --dport 161 -j ACCEPT

/etc/init.d/iptables restart #重啟防火牆使配置生效

2、安裝net-snmp(這里使用CentOS的yum命令在線安裝)

yum -y install net-snmp

chkconfig snmpd on #設置開機啟動

service snmpd start #啟動snmpd

2、配置snmp

mv /etc/snmp/snmpd.conf /etc/snmp/snmpd.confbak #備份配置文件

vi snmpd.conf #添加下面代碼

com2sec notConfigUser default public
group notConfigGroup v1 notConfigUser
group notConfigGroup v2c notConfigUser
view systemview included .1
access notConfigGroup "" any noauth exact systemview none none
syslocation www.osyunwei.com
pass .1.3.6.1.4.1.4413.4.1 /usr/bin/ucd5820stat

系統運維 溫馨提醒:qihang01原創內容版權所有,轉載請注明出處及原文鏈接

:wq! #保存退出

service snmpd restart #重啟snmp

netstat -nlup |grep ":161" #檢查snmp服務器是否運行,出現下面輸出結果,說明snmp運行正常

udp 0 0 0.0.0.0:161 0.0.0.0:* 3265/snmpd

三、設置CactiEZ對Windows和Linux進行監控

以下操作在登錄之后進行

1、添加對Windows主機的監控

管理-主機,點添加

相關選項都有具體中文說明:

特別注意:

主機名:要監控的主機的IP地址,這里是192.168.21.130

主機模板:選擇Windows主機

監視主機:后面打勾,表示啟用

SNMP團體名稱:務必要與Windows主機之前設置的SNMP團體名稱相同,否則監控失敗,這里是public

SNMP端口:默認是161

其他選項默認即可

最后,點保存,會出現下面的界面

系統運維 溫馨提醒:qihang01原創內容版權所有,轉載請注明出處及原文鏈接

點擊為這個主機添加圖形,根據自己需要監控的對象選中右邊的復選框,點添加

注意,最后一項,選擇一個圖形類型,32位主機選擇流入/流出 位 ;64位主機選擇流入/流出 (64位)

出現下面界面,再點添加

點上面導航欄的監視器,進入監視界面

點擊打開我們剛才添加的主機,已經可以看到監控的圖形了,只是這個時候還沒有數據,數據采集是1分鍾輪詢一次

等待幾分鍾之后,刷新,會看到下面的界面,這個時候已經有了監控數據了。

Windows 主機監控設置完成

2、添加對Linux主機的監控

添加方法與Windows相同

注意:主機名字填寫Linux主機的IP,主機模板選擇Linux主機

最后點添加,再點 為這個主機添加圖形,根據自己需要監控的對象選中右邊的復選框,點添加

出現下面界面,再點添加

然后點上面導航欄的監視器,進入監視界面,選擇剛才添加的Linux主機

系統運維 溫馨提醒:qihang01原創內容版權所有,轉載請注明出處及原文鏈接

同樣等待幾分鍾之后,會看到如下的監控數據

Linux 主機監控設置完成

3、設置CactiEZ郵件報警功能

控制台-配置-設置-郵件/域名解析

這里我們使用163的郵箱來發信,如果沒有163郵件,請注冊一個!

測試郵件: 這里填寫一個測試的收件地址,可以是QQ郵箱等其他郵箱,

也可以填寫與發件人地址相同的郵箱,即自己給自己發一份測試郵件

郵件服務:SMTP

發件人地址:

發件人:

SMTP服務器主機名:smtp.163.com

SMTP端口:25

SMTP用戶名:****** 這里填寫發信郵箱的用戶名(郵件地址中前面的部分就是用戶名)

SMTP密碼:****** 輸入你的電子郵箱登陸密碼

主要DNS服務器的IP地址:8.8.8.8

次要DNS服務器IP地址:8.8.4.4

設置好之后 保存 ,再點右上角的“發送一封測試郵件”

看到下面的信息表示郵件測試成功

同時163的郵箱也會收到一封測試郵件

最后,切換到 報警/閥值 選項

主機宕機通知:后面打勾

主機宕機通知郵件: 這里填寫主機宕機時的收信郵件地址,推薦使用移動的139免費郵箱

當主機宕機的時候,會從 自動發送一份宕機報告郵件到 郵箱,

同時你的手機也會收到一條短信提示,即使當時你沒有看到郵件,通過查看短信也能隨時隨地監控您的主機運行狀態

系統運維 溫馨提醒:qihang01原創內容版權所有,轉載請注明出處及原文鏈接

郵件選項

發件人地址:

發件人名稱:

最后保存

現在,CactiEZ郵件報警功能設置完成,如果有某一台主機宕機的話,上面設置的139郵箱會收到一封宕機郵件,

同時手機也會收到一條短信

至此,CactiEZ 中文版V10.1安裝使用以及139郵箱短信報警設置完成

 


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M